Requesting an SSL Certificate: Understanding the CSR Process
Generating a SSL certificate application employs a critical step known as a Certificate Signing Request|CSR. This document acts as your formal application for an SSL certificate, providing the CA with the necessary information to verify your entity. The CSR procedure begins by generating a unique private key and then creating a public key from it. This public key, coupled with other essential details about your domain, is afterwards encoded into the CSR {format|. This document{ is then provided to a certified CA for review and authorization.
- Throughout the validation process,, the CA will authenticate your ownership of the URL by examining documents and conducting background checks.
- Upon successful validation, the CA will generate an SSL certificate, which encompasses your public key and other important information. This certificate can then be installed on your hosting platform to secure your communications.

First, let's explore what a CSR is and its importance in the SSL certificate process. A CSR is essentially a demand sent to a Certificate Authority (CA), containing specific information about your organization and domain. The CA then examines this request and, if successful, issues an SSL certificate that proves your identity online.
- To begin the CSR generation, you'll need a few essentials:
- {The Windows OpenSSL toolkit: This powerful application is essential for generating your CSR. You can obtain it from the official OpenSSL website.
- {A text editor: You'll need a plain text editor to write the configuration file for OpenSSL. Notepad or any similar program will do.
- {Your domain name information: You'll need your domain name, as well as your organization's details (name, address, etc.)
